Mercy Health

Mercy Health, formerly Catholic Health Partners, is a Catholic health care system with locations in and . -based Mercy Health operates more than 250 healthcare organizations in Ohio and Kentucky.

The , also known as Norwood City Hall, is a historic government building at 4645 Montgomery Road in , . The building was constructed in 1914-16 on the site of Norwood's first city hall, which was built in 1881. -based architecture firm Weber, Werner & Adkins designed the building in the Second Renaissance Revival style. is situated 3,600 feet southeast of Mercy Health.
